95 Buell S2 - originally setup as a Hot Street bike. 88" motor, Force Pro Pipe, 1999 Rods/flywheels/tranny, 3 13/16" Millinum Cylinders, new CP 10.5:1 pistons, Jims roller rockers and hydrosolids, fresh lightning heads, RedShift 643 cams with trimmed cam cover, Super G carb, new S&S intake, new crane coil, crane hi-4 ignition, 7/8" Vortex clip ons, 520 chain, 10" extended swingarm. Last dyno showed just under 120 rwhp and about 105 ft lbs. tq. Bike has a clean title. Can be ridden on the street, drag raced, or both (as I do). $8000. |
